Transaction 08d324434d35093766a2a87a6597f128e1d49ca5da88ac319313a6c98d2921e5

1 Input
2 Outputs
  • 08d324434d35093766a2a87a6597f128e1d49ca5da88ac319313a6c98d2921e5:0
  • value  2425631647
    address  37HynGbak4ehN52kSaFQBFxLqeokdt2PNw
  • 08d324434d35093766a2a87a6597f128e1d49ca5da88ac319313a6c98d2921e5:1
  • value  100000000
    address  14vTDFTm7WmkAHuFgYZmU95RXCTpDoQe7k